Gregory L. Milligan is a scholar working on Organic Chemistry, Molecular Biology and Electrical and Electronic Engineering. According to data from OpenAlex, Gregory L. Milligan has authored 14 papers receiving a total of 817 indexed citations (citations by other indexed papers that have themselves been cited), including 12 papers in Organic Chemistry, 4 papers in Molecular Biology and 2 papers in Electrical and Electronic Engineering. Recurrent topics in Gregory L. Milligan's work include Synthesis and Catalytic Reactions (8 papers), Click Chemistry and Applications (5 papers) and Chemical Synthesis and Analysis (4 papers). Gregory L. Milligan is often cited by papers focused on Synthesis and Catalytic Reactions (8 papers), Click Chemistry and Applications (5 papers) and Chemical Synthesis and Analysis (4 papers). Gregory L. Milligan collaborates with scholars based in United States. Gregory L. Milligan's co-authors include Jeffrey Aubé, Craig J. Mossman, Vijaya Gracias, Kevin J. Frankowski, Ruzhang Liu, Kevin D. Moeller, Pankaj Desai, Klaas Schildknegt, Konstantinos A. Agrios and Kristine E. Frank and has published in prestigious journals such as Journal of the American Chemical Society, Angewandte Chemie International Edition and The Journal of Organic Chemistry.
